The Philadelphia Eagles have acquired defensive end Jaelan Phillips from the Miami Dolphins in a trade, the teams announced. The deal, finalized on November 3, 2025, marks a significant move for the Eagles as they bolster their pass rush ahead of the playoff push. Details of the draft compensation were not disclosed, but the trade signals Philadelphia’s intent to strengthen its defense in the final stretch of the season.
